This guide has originally been prepared by Jakob Berg Jespersen (jakob@iscb.org)

Getting sponsors is not always easy, and even with multiple emails and good personal/professional connections, it can be hard to get a deal.

Meeting in person with a representative is a great way to get in touch with the right people inside a company.

This is thought to be a support document to help the process of calling out companies, which can be great as we dont need to wait for a confrence to tak place, and it offers a more personal interaction than an email.

A call can either be made with or without having sent an email beforehand.
